Which number is 5.389 rounded to the nearest hundredth? A 5.4 B 5.38 © 5.39 05.399
ankoles [38]

Answer:

c) 5.39

Step-by-step explanation:

The digit that is in the hundredths place is the 8. (The hundredths are two digits to the right of the point).

The thousandths in this case would be the 9, since the 9 is close to the next hundredth, the nearest hundredth would be 9 (adding 1 to the 8), therefore the number would be 5.39

What is the smallest whole number that is a multiple of 5, 9, and 12?
Marianna [84]

Answer:180

Step-by-step explanation:

you start by finding the prime factorization of the number

5=1*5

9=3*3

12=2*2*3

the shortest way to find the factors is to find is most of them like example, at max, there are 2 two's, 2 three's and 1 five then you multiply them all together

4*9*5=180 and that's the answer

* At first lets talk about the general form of the conic equation

- Ax² + Bxy + Cy²  + Dx + Ey + F = 0

∵ B² - 4AC < 0 , if a conic exists, it will be either a circle or an ellipse.

∵ B² - 4AC = 0 , if a conic exists, it will be a parabola.

∵ B² - 4AC > 0 , if a conic exists, it will be a hyperbola.

* Now we will study our equation:

 xy = -8

∵ A = 0 , B = 1 , C = 0

∴ B² - 4 AC = (1)² - 4(0)(0) = 1 > 0

∴ B² - 4AC > 0

∴ The graph is hyperbola
